Synchronica PLC 11 July 2007 Synchronica Syncs Apple's iPhone to Microsoft Exchange Mobile Gateway 3.0 continues to support widest range of feature phones and Smartphones on the market Tunbridge Wells - 11 July, 2007 - Synchronica plc, an international provider of mobile synchronization and device management solutions, today announced that Mobile Gateway 3.0 supports over-the-air synchronization between Microsoft Exchange and the newly launched Apple iPhone. This will allow mobile operators and service providers to offer mobile synchronization to business users and prosumers, enabling them to receive corporate e-mail on their iPhones without having to ask their IT manager to open the firewall or install additional software. Mobile Gateway seamlessly integrates with the corporate IT infrastructure and does not require the enterprise to expose IMAP and SMTP in their Exchange servers or install additional connectors - issues that often raise security concerns with IT administrators. Instead, Mobile Gateway uses Microsoft's secure Outlook Web Access (OWA) to retrieve e-mail from the corporate Exchange server, a service enabled by many enterprises to provide users with access to corporate e-mail from home or while traveling. Unlike other solutions Mobile Gateway 3.0 delivers e-mails directly to the built-in e-mail client of the Apple iPhone. Users will be able to benefit from the outstanding user experience of the built-in e-mail client of the iPhone and its tight integration with the phone's address book. The iPhone is the latest device to be supported by Synchronica's Mobile Gateway 3.0 middleware, which enables synchronization with a wide range of Smartphones and mass-market feature phones from Nokia, Sony Ericsson, and other leading manufacturers. Synchronica was one of the first synchronization software vendors to combine both SyncML (OMA DS), which is optimized for synchronization of calendar and contacts, and Push-IMAP (LEMONADE), which is optimized for mobile e-mail. Millions of mobile phones support e-mail over IMAP, but IMAP does not support calendar or contact synchronization. Thus, combining Push IMAP for mobile e-mail with SyncML (OMA DS) for synchronization of calendar and contacts allows Synchronica to support the widest range of devices and the most popular content types. Synchronica's Mobile Gateway provides carrier-grade Push e-mail and synchronization services for both consumers and business users. Serving consumers, it includes back-end support for POP3 and IMAP, connecting to popular mail services such as AOL or Yahoo. For business users, it provides a unique "zero footprint" architecture where users simply register their devices with Mobile Gateway and instantly start to receive Push e-mail on their devices--no connectors behind the firewall are required. It includes built-in support for Microsoft Exchange, Lotus Notes, and Sun JES, thereby reaching the majority of business user mail systems.
